One golden spoon of ten shekels, full of incense:
One gold spoon weighing ten shekels, filled with incense.
This verse describes one of the precious gold vessels filled with sweet-smelling incense that was given as an offering to God.
📚 Historical Context
In the Book of Numbers, chapter 7 details the dedication offerings presented by the leaders of the twelve tribes of Israel to the newly constructed tabernacle, which served as the central place of worship during their wilderness journey. Each leader brought identical items, including a golden spoon full of incense, as part of a coordinated act of devotion to God, symbolizing purity and the role of incense in priestly rituals. This event occurred shortly after the tabernacle's completion, highlighting the Israelites' commitment to organized worship in their nomadic life.
